3月27日,PolygonzkEVM主网测试版本正式上线发布,以太坊创始人VitalikButerin已在PolygonzkEVM主网上完成了其首笔交易。
不过,MATIC代币价格并没有因此按照用户预期上涨,反而24小时内还下跌了5%,现报价1.04美元。当然,这在一定程度上受大盘的影响,主要原因是目前仅为测试版上线,或许需要等主网正式上线才能真正看到影响。
相比币安的FUD事件,市场对于zkEVM主网测试版的关注热度似乎并不高。尽管如此,PolygonzkEVM主网的发布,说明ZKRollup扩容方案在与EVM兼容的问题上已有重大突破。
PolygonzkEVM主网与现有的大多数以太坊智能合约、开发工具和钱包都可以无缝协作,支持以太坊开发者一键迁移应用至链上;用户也可通过熟悉的以太坊钱包使用“zkEVM-testnetRPC”节点体验其链上生态应用。
根据PolygonzkEVM浏览器显示,主网测试版上线不到24小时内,已完成7821笔交易,提交了598批交易,生成了7873个区块。
PolygonzkEVM原理
PolygonzkEVM是基于ZKRollup技术搭建的以太坊Layer2层zkEVM扩容方案,ZKRollup是利用“零知识证明”验证方式来落实Rollup的扩容方案。
具体来说,在ZKRollup扩容方案下,链下执行交易、完成复杂计算,将多个交易数据批量处理压缩打包之后,会创建一个链下计算的“零知识证明”结果,提交至主网进行证明校验,主网上验证者可以快速检查此证明是否正确,并将数据部分存储在在主网上,共享主网的安全性。
零知识证明的数据验证方式正是OptimisticRollup与ZKRollup重要的区别。前者使用的是“欺诈证明”,需要有异议期,所以L2到L1转账需要等待期;后者使用的是零知识证明算法,可以即时检查数据的有效性,转账无任何等待。
但由于ZKRollup使用的零知识证明算法比较复杂,无法兼容以太坊虚拟机,这使得以太坊上的应用想要在该链上部署,开发者不但需要重新构建这个应用还需重新学习适用于该方案的底层代码语言,可谓费时费力。这也是为什么一直说“扩容方案短期看OptimisticRollup,长期看ZKRollup”的原因。
为了解决与EVM兼容的这个问题,ZKRollup系扩容方案有的重新设计了底层编程语言,有的开发了特殊的编译器来实现兼容。
除了PolygonzkEVM,市场上已经有多家项目在研究和部署zkEVM相关产品,正在竞相推出“第一个”功能齐全的zkEVM。如,3月24日,zkSyncEra主网正式发布,并向用户开放,该主网是zkEVM解决方案;2月份,ScrollzkEVM宣布其Alpha测试网现已在Goerli上线;StarkNet正在构建与EVM兼容的编译器,主网也即将发布等等。
那么,PolygonzkEVM与这些zkEVM项目有何区别?
PolygonzkEVM属于完全等效于EVM,即开发人员无需修改任何代码就可将与EVM兼容的链上应用迁移至该链上,也可使用所有以太坊工具在zkEVM链上无缝协作。
ZKRollup与EVM等效级别究竟意味什么?
真正与EVM等效的ZKRollups,为开发人员提供了与在以太坊上开发相同的体验,支持开发人员可以使用在以太坊主网上开发时所用的所有相同工具和框架,而不必担心L1合约在L2链上部署时中断。这对于开发人员来说至关重要,因为这意味着从L1迁移L2时的开销要少得多。而用户也可从EVM等效链中获益,EVM等效链的用户可使用以太坊主网上熟悉的的钱包及工具。
去年8月,以太坊创始人Vitalik曾在发表的名为《ThedifferenttypesofZK-EVMs不同类型的ZK-EVM》博客中,将zkEVM兼容性按等级划分,可分为四类:完全等效以太坊、完全等效EVM、几乎等效于EVM和高级程序式语言等效。
2月15日,Polygon官方发文表示PolygonzkEVM已经通过100%适用于zkEVM的以太坊测试向量,开发人员无需修改或重写任何代码,且所有以太坊工具都可以与PolygonzkEVM无缝协作,已实现完全等效于EVM。
PolygonzkEVM将如何影响Polygon生态?
除了产品和技术上的创新值得关注外,对于大多数普通用户来说,更关注的是PolygonzkEVM主网Beta上线对于原有的PolygonPoS侧链以及Polygon生态代币MATIC会有哪些影响?
根据DefiLlama数据显示,截至3月28日,PolygonPoS链上锁仓的加密资产价值为10.64亿美元,在整个公链赛道排名第四,24小时链上活跃的地址数为36万。不过,TVL在近30天内下降了8%左右。
MATIC的币价和链上TVL的数据表现似乎反应了PolygonzkEVM市场关注度一般。
此外,有人质疑:“PolygonzkEVM出来后会不会取代PolygonPOS?”
Polygon官方对此回答是“NO”,表示zkEVM不是用来取代POS侧链的。
Polygon联合创始人MihailoBjelic也曾在一次采访中表示,“PolygonzkEVM上线将是一个单独运行的区块网络,PolygonPOS链将继续作为侧链运作。Polygon生态内将有两个并行运行的网络,具有不同的价值主张,即功能和权衡,开发者可根据对安全性、可扩展性和交易费用不同相应地选择网络。只不过,POS侧链不如ZKRollup安全,因为ZKRollup会将其交易数据是存储在以太坊主链上的,与以太坊区块链继承底层相同的安全性;POS侧链的数据存在自己链上,而不是不存储在以太坊上。”
另外,MihailoBjelic也补充道,计划PolygonPOS链进行一些基于ZK的增强,区块链押注这种扩展技术可以推动其生态系统发展。探索如何将ZK技术集成到PolygonPOS链中,来提高POS链的安全性。不过,他也表示,如果PolygonPOS变得与ZK兼容,它只是使用像ZKRollups中的证明来确保交易不被,它依旧不将数据存储在以太坊上,而是存储在自己网络上或其它链下的单独网络上。与ZKRollup不同,它不将数据存储在以太坊上,而是在链下的单独网络上。
既然,PolygonzkEVM是一条单独的区块网络,也有不少用户困惑,它还会发行单独的代币吗?
PolygonzkEVM在官方介绍文档中表示,使用原生代币ETH用于支付zkEVM链上GAS费用。MATIC可以用于链上质押治理。关于是否发行新代币,Polygon联创SandeepNailwal早在推特上发文表示,“有太多人询问代币的问题,MATIC将成为Polygon生态内的链上质押代币,链上GAS费的默认代币为ETH。”
由此来看,MATIC在Polygon生态中承担的角色是治理Token,主要用于PolygonzkEVM网络及其它链的安全运营及维护,如在PolygonPOS侧链上质押MATIC成为运营节点;在zkEVM上质押MATIC获得提交交易数据的排序权等。ETH仅作为链上GAS费的支付手段。
PolygonzkEVM链上生态应用有哪些?
根据zkRollup的安全性交高,GAS费较低,交易数据可实时验证,转账无需等待等特点,PolygonzkEVM链上更适合用于构建DeFi,NFT、Gamefi和企业应用程序,支付等应用。
目前,PolygonzkEVM上已经官宣了不少合作生态。3月24日,Web3游戏开发商zkMeta将在Polygon网络上使用zkEVM建立GameFi专用的zkRollup网络;3月20日,游戏公链Immutable宣布和Polygon构建专用游zkEVM戏区块链;3月28日,Layer2跨Rollup桥OrbiterFinance宣布已集成PolygonzkEVM网络,允许用户在PolygonzkEVM与支持的其他网络间跨链转移资产。
除了合作项目外,PolygonzkEVM链上还有原生的跨链桥、DEX等产品。
官方跨链桥zkEVMBridge——支持用户在L1、zkEVM之间转移资产。目前,仅支持用户在zkEVM-testnet和以太坊GoerliTestnet之间转移ETH。
去中心化交易平台Clober——是zkEVM链上原生的订单簿式DEX,可在链上实现订单匹配和交易结算。
借贷应用0VIX——是一个超额抵押借贷平台,支持zkEVM搭建的用户存入或抵押借出资产。
此外,Polygon官方为了纪念zkEVM主网测试版上线,还发行了纪念NFT“ToEthereum,withLove”,现已开放铸造,不妨先Mint一个体验下。
公众号:Crypto马少
郑重声明: 本文版权归原作者所有, 转载文章仅为传播更多信息之目的, 如作者信息标记有误, 请第一时间联系我们修改或删除, 多谢。